A Pokémon booster box is the ideal choice for collectors and players who want to open multiple booster packs from a set at once. Each box contains factory-sealed boosters from a series and offers an intense opening experience with the chance to unlock rare cards, hit cards, and chase cards. Booster boxes are suitable for collecting complete sets as well as for strategically building decks. Those who want to buy a Pokémon booster box benefit from a better price per booster compared to buying them individually. Furthermore, they receive guaranteed genuine products directly from sealed displays. Booster boxes are popular with collectors, players, and investors because they combine excitement, collectability, and long-term potential.
Pokemon Booster Box German
A German-language Pokémon booster box is particularly popular in the Swiss market. German cards are easy to understand, popular with beginners, and often preferred for local tournaments or collections. Many current sets are released simultaneously in German and offer the same card content as other language versions.
Pokemon Booster Box (English)
The English version of the Pokémon booster box is the most widely distributed internationally. English cards are traded worldwide and are very popular among competitive players. Those who value maximum flexibility when trading, selling, or playing often opt for English booster boxes from current or popular sets.

A Japanese Pokémon booster box offers a unique collecting experience. Japanese sets are often released earlier than Western versions and sometimes contain exclusive cards or alternative designs. The print quality is considered very high, which is why Japanese booster boxes are particularly sought after by experienced collectors and enthusiasts.
Pokemon Booster Box 1999
A 1999 Pokémon booster box is an absolute rarity in the Pokémon TCG. These vintage displays date back to the early days of Pokémon cards and are now very rarely available unopened. Original booster boxes from this era are considered valuable collector's items and long-term investments. What is a Pokémon TCG Booster Box?
A booster box (also called a display) typically contains 36 sealed booster packs from a specific series. It is ideal for collectors and players who want to open many Pokémon cards at once and expand their collection in a targeted way.

How many cards are included in a booster box?
A display box containing 36 booster packs contains several hundred cards, depending on the series. Each booster pack contains at least one rare card. The exact number of cards per pack varies by set.

Are there guaranteed hits or specific cards per display?
No. The distribution of cards is based on chance. There is no guarantee of getting specific Secret Rares, Alternate Arts, or other Chase cards. It is precisely this uncertainty that makes Pokémon Trading Cards so exciting for many.

What is the difference between English and Japanese displays?
English displays usually contain 36 booster packs and are the most common internationally. Japanese displays often have fewer packs per box, different pull rates, and sometimes different card sequences or exclusive cards.

Are booster boxes a suitable investment?
Many collectors keep sealed booster boxes long-term, as certain sets can increase in value. However, an increase in value is never guaranteed and depends heavily on the set, demand, and condition.
